Clinker Facade Brick – A Durable and Elegant Exterior Solution
Clinker facade brick is one of the most durable materials used for finishing building exteriors.
Clinker bricks are made from high-quality clay that is fired at extremely high temperatures.
This process gives them exceptional resistance to weather conditions, moisture and mechanical damage.
A clinker brick facade is not only durable but also highly aesthetic. Natural brick colors –
from classic red and brown to modern graphite tones – make buildings look elegant and timeless.

Clinker brick facade vs handmade brick
When choosing materials for a building exterior, homeowners often compare clinker bricks
with handmade bricks. Both solutions are used for decorative brick facades, but they offer
slightly different visual effects.
Handmade bricks typically have a more irregular texture and a rustic appearance.
They are often used when a more traditional or historic look is desired.
Clinker bricks, on the other hand, usually have a more uniform structure and smoother
surface. Because of that they are frequently used in contemporary architectural projects.
Where can clinker bricks be used?
Clinker facade materials are used not only for exterior walls but also for many architectural elements.
- house facades
- garden walls and fences
- chimneys and building plinths
- decorative exterior walls
- architectural facade accents
In many modern projects, thin brick slips are also used. They provide the visual
effect of a traditional brick wall while reducing wall thickness and installation weight.
